Dean Olson, a passionate songwriter and podcaster, embodies the spirit of encouragement and hope for aspiring musicians. Through his platform, “Strongwriter On the Radio,” Dean aims to uplift songwriters of all backgrounds, helping them navigate the often tumultuous journey of pursuing their dreams. His tagline, “Helping Songwriters Become Musically Fit,” captures his mission to infuse creativity with resilience.
Understanding that many songwriters face emotional challenges and setbacks, Dean provides a supportive environment where they can gain strength and inspiration. He offers practical songwriting tips alongside uplifting articles and engaging interviews with music industry veterans. By sharing stories from well-known artists like Richard M. Sherman, Thomas Dolby and Toni Tennille, as well as producers and independent musicians, Dean fosters a sense of community among creators.
Since launching his radio show in 2014 and expanding into podcasting in 2019, Dean has reached millions worldwide. His dedication to empowering others is evident in every episode as he encourages listeners to embrace their unique voices. With the help of Raven Blair Glover, a successful media entrepreneur, Dean has transformed his lifelong dream into a reality.
